What is Job Hazard Analysis?

Job Hazard Analysis (JHA) is a systematic process that aims to identify potential hazards and risks associated with a particular job or task. It provides a structured approach to mitigating these hazards through the analysis of individual steps involved in the job. By breaking down the job into smaller components, JHA enables organizations to identify and implement appropriate control measures to reduce the likelihood of accidents or injuries.

The Steps in Job Hazard Analysis

  1. Select the Job – Choose a specific job or task to analyze with JHA.
  2. Break Down the Job – Divide the job into individual steps or tasks.
  3. Identify Hazards – Analyze each step to identify potential hazards or risks.
  4. Assess Risks – Evaluate the severity and probability of each identified hazard.
  5. Implement Controls – Determine and implement appropriate control measures to mitigate the identified hazards.
  6. Train and Communicate – Ensure that all workers involved in the job are trained on the identified hazards and control measures.
  7. Periodic Review – Regularly review and update the JHA to account for changes in the job or workplace environment.

Understanding Risk Assessment

Risk assessment involves a comprehensive evaluation of the overall risk level associated with a particular endeavor. It goes beyond simply identifying hazards and examines the likelihood and severity of those hazards, as well as the measures required to mitigate risks effectively. By considering not only individual hazards but also their interactions and the context in which they occur, risk assessment provides organizations with invaluable insights for decision-making and resource allocation.

Key Steps in Risk Assessment

  1. Identifying Hazards: The first step in risk assessment is to identify potential hazards that could pose a threat to the project or activity at hand. This could include physical hazards like machinery or chemical hazards like toxic substances.
  2. Assessing Likelihood and Severity: Once hazards are identified, their likelihood and severity must be evaluated. This helps prioritize risks and determines the level of attention and resources required for risk mitigation. A comparison table can be used to illustrate the likelihood and severity of each hazard.
  3. Determining Control Measures: Based on the assessed risks, appropriate control measures should be established to manage and mitigate them effectively. Control measures may include engineering controls, administrative controls, or personal protective equipment.
  4. Implementing Control Measures: After determining the control measures, they should be implemented promptly to reduce or eliminate the identified risks. Regular monitoring and evaluation should be conducted to ensure the effectiveness of these measures.

Key Differences

In this section, we will delve into the key differences between Job Hazard Analysis (JHA) and Risk Assessment. While both processes aim to identify and mitigate risks, they differ in scope and focus. Understanding these differences is crucial for effectively managing safety in the workplace.

Job Hazard Analysis (JHA)

JHA is a systematic process used to identify and control potential hazards associated with specific jobs or tasks. It involves a detailed analysis of individual steps involved in performing a job. Here are the key points to note about JHA:

  • Focuses on specific jobs or tasks.
  • Analyzes each step of the job in detail.
  • Identifies potential hazards and their associated risks.
  • Determines appropriate control measures to mitigate risks.
  • Emphasizes hazard identification and control.

Risk Assessment

Risk assessment, on the other hand, takes a broader approach and considers the overall risk landscape. It evaluates the likelihood and severity of hazards to determine the level of risk associated with a particular activity or situation. Here’s what you need to know about risk assessment:

  • Takes a comprehensive approach.
  • Considers the overall risk landscape.
  • Evaluates likelihood and severity of hazards.
  • Determines the level of risk associated with an activity.
  • Considers a wide range of factors influencing risk.

Key Points

To summarize, here are the key points differentiating JHA and risk assessment:

  1. Scope: JHA focuses on specific jobs or tasks, while risk assessment takes a broader approach and considers the overall risk landscape.
  2. Analysis: JHA involves a detailed analysis of individual steps, whereas risk assessment takes a comprehensive approach.
  3. Focus: JHA emphasizes hazard identification and control measures, while risk assessment evaluates the likelihood and severity of hazards.
  4. Risk Evaluation: JHA identifies potential risks, while risk assessment determines the level of risk associated with an activity or situation.
  5. Control Measures: JHA primarily focuses on hazard control, while risk assessment considers a wider range of factors influencing risk.

By understanding these key differences, organizations can choose the most appropriate method for managing risks and ensuring workplace safety.

In conclusion, Job Hazard Analysis and Risk Assessment are both valuable tools for identifying and mitigating risks. While JHA focuses on specific jobs or tasks with a detailed analysis of individual steps, risk assessment takes a broader approach and considers the overall risk landscape. Each method has its own strengths and should be used based on the specific needs and goals of an organization.
